How to Behave
Tips on cultural norms and respectful behavior
Respectful clothing is advised in public spaces; shoulders and knees should be covered.
Always request permission from individuals before taking their photo.
If invited to someone’s home, bring a small gift and remove shoes if asked.
Use polite language, avoid public confrontation, and observe prayer times in mosques.

Tipping in Chahār Borj-e Qadīm
Ensure a smooth experience
Tipping is appreciated but not mandatory; rounding up the bill or leaving 5-10% in restaurants is common; small tips for hotel staff and drivers are welcome.
Cash is widely used (Iranian Rial or Toman); some larger establishments may accept debit or card payments, but cash is safest in rural towns.
